Viết chương trình nhập k và n số nguyên từ bàn phím. a. Đếm trong dãy có bao nhiêu số bằng k. b. Tìm số nguyên tố lớn nhất của dãy.
2 câu trả lời
uses crt;
var a:array[1..234]of longint;
n,max,i,k,d:longint;
begin
clrscr;
write('nhap n');
readln(n);
write('nhap k');
readln(k);
i:=0;
d:=0;
repeat
begin
i:=i+1;
write('a[',i,']=');
readln(a[i]);
if a[i]=k then d:=d+1;
end;
until
i=n;
max:=a[1];
for i:=2 to n do
if max<a[i] then max:=a[i];
writeln('co',d,'= ',k);
writeln('gia tri lon nhat',max);
readln
end.
Program baitap;
Uses crt;
Var A:array[1..200] of integer;
i,n,k,dem,max:integer;
Begin
Clrscr;
Write('k='); Readln(k);
Write('n='); Readln(n);
dem:=0;
For i:=1 to n do
Begin
Write('Nhap phan tu thu ',i);
Readln(A[i]);
If A[i]=0 then dem:=dem+1;
End;
max:=A[i];
For i:=2 to n do
If A[i]>max then max:=A[i];
Writeln('Co ',dem,' so trong day bang ',k);
Writeln('So nguyen lon nhat tron day:',max);
Readln
End.